- The beast they refer to in the video is the reader's demanding constant news and information. Reporters have to continuously feed both what they find newsworthy, as well as what the public will find newsworthy. Reporters work around the clock to find the most relevant news and to present it in a meaningful and interesting way. The news is the only way the public can be informed about whats going on around the world and how news will effect them. The video also showed that reporters try to think from the readers perspective and look to remain credible.
-Due to the 24-hour news cycle in print, tv, and internet reporters are pressed to meet deadlines and gather all the relevant information before that happens. Reporters run into problems when they can't get the facts or interviews they need. In this circumstance, a good story may not make the news. It was also interesting to learn how relevant trust is between peers. Reporters must trust the members of their team.
